Ordained as a priest in 1956, served in various roles within the Catholic Church. Became Bishop of Arundel and Brighton in 1977 and later appointed Archbishop of Westminster in 2000. Played a significant role in the Catholic Church in England and Wales during the early 21st century. Participated in the 2005 papal conclave that elected Pope Benedict XVI and later attended the 2013 conclave for Pope Francis. Advocated for social justice and interfaith dialogue, emphasizing the importance of community and faith in public life.
